Unlock your full potential in the water with the perfect pair of fins. Choosing the right fins can noticeably influence your performance by improving your propulsion. Fins come in a variety of models, each suited to specific swimming techniques.
Consider your experience level when making your choice. Newbies may benefit from shorter, soft fins for better stability, while experienced swimmers may opt for longer, stiffer fins for increased speed.
